Orienteering race 1:09:38 [3] ** 5.34 mi (13:02 / mi) +106m 12:17 / mi
20c shoes: Blue Xtalon 2017

Meet 13 Race 15
MVOC Taylorsville Red 6.5 km

This was so, so frustrating!!

I made errors-- a smaller route choice error on 2, lost time on control 4 which was hidden (wedged between a set of closely spaced trees and a small rock wall), not reading the clue for 8 while simultaneously not visualizing the terrain well, and I probably took a poor route to 10.
But leaving 10, I was confused. There was the guy who had told me before the race that they may not have uniformly told people to cross the road by the trail underpass. I did this arriving at control 6 (which was a common control 6/10/17) as it was the obvious path. Leaving the same control going from 10 to 11, I needed to cross the N-S railway tracks but this was now harder because of the train parked on them. So I ran S expecting their to be a tunnel under the tracks but there was not. I ran along the gravel bed for a bit and got trapped behind the pile of rail ties. Climbed them and went back to 10 deciding the only way to go was next to the road but 5 min had been lost. Coming back the train was gone so I could go to 17 across the tracks and finished the race with only minor incidents. George was confused but decided much quicker that the only crossing was the bridge and he used it twice. My frustration was the lack of clarity about what was in bounds. I grumbled when I got home to Aragorn, went to sleep and then talked about the race with Brenda. At that point, she noticed that the clue sheet said how to get to 6 (use the underpass) and to use the road bridge to 11 and 17, both as text statements at the place in the clue sheet where it would be needed. I never saw these during the race, after the race, or talking to George or Aidan after the race; I hadn't read them because I had no expectation they might be there. These text directions assumed that this is how a clue sheet was to be used, maybe that the sheet would be reviewed before the race. If there is a special symbol, then I am looking for the text descriptor but that is the only place. Meet notes with special hazards and instructions should be given before the race. I had got informal and not wholly accurate instructions from the guy in the parking lot but was unprepared, chose badly, and then had the second half of the race to let my humor percolate. Sigh.
